What is Vinland Saga?
Fast forward fifteen years to 1002 AD in a quiet village in Iceland. Thors now lives a peaceful life with his wife Helga, his teenage daughter Ylva, and his spirited six-year-old son, Thorfinn. Young Thorfinn is enamored with the tales of the adventurer Leif Erikson, who speaks of a fertile, warm paradise to the west called Vinland—a land free of war and slavery.
